Edmonton Community Foundation seeks a Student Awards Associate focused on organizational excellence in a full-time role. Help coordinate student awards and grant applications with precision and care.
In this temporary position, you will manage ECF's student awards programs under the direction of the Grants and Community Initiatives Director. You will foster solid relationships with students and educational institutions, ensuring accessible and efficient application processes while promoting award opportunities to drive community engagement. Building trust through clear communication is essential as you navigate these vital programs.
Key Responsibilities:
• Coordinate student award application processes
• Engage educational institutions to promote award programs
• Support selection committees and manage applications
• Ensure timely award decisions and accurate payments
• Analyze and refine program processes for improved outcomes
Requirements:
• 3-5 years of related work experience
• Degree in business administration or social sciences
• Proficiency in grant management software
•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
• Strong attention to detail and organization
